Structured medication reviews for patients with polypharmacy in primary care: a cross-sectional study in North West London, UK. JRSM Open 2025; 16:20542704251325056. Abstract
Objectives To identify the number and characteristics of patients with polypharmacy receiving structured medication reviews (SMRs) and medication reviews in primary care in 2022, and to evaluate whether the provision of these services is equitable across different demographic and socio-economic groups. Design Cross-sectional study. Setting Primary care networks in North West London, UK. Participants Adults registered with a general practitioner (GP) and regularly prescribed at least five medicines or more. Main outcome measures Receipt of at least one SMR and any kind of medication review during the study period (2022). Results Among 515,042 adults regularly prescribed with medication, 167,482 were regularly prescribed at least five medicines, defined as polypharmacy. 53.3% (89,220) of these patients received at least one kind of medication review and 17.2% (11,954) of them received SMRs. Patients who were males, black, more affluent, and frailer, were more likely to receive medication reviews, while those who were males, less affluent, and frailer, were more likely to receive SMRs. Conclusions Although polypharmacy was common in North West London, only about half of eligible patients received medication reviews, and only 17.2% received SMRs. Different distributions of medication reviews and SMRs by demographic and socio-economic characteristics may indicate inequities in the provision of these services. Policy makers should consider effective ways to incentivise the equitable provision of SMRs.

Management of patients with epilepsy and Intellectual disabilities in group homes vs. Family Homes: Insights into polypharmacy and seizure characteristics. Epilepsy Behav 2024; 152:109639. Abstract
OBJECTIVES This study aimed to investigate the differences in ASMs prescription, seizure characteristics and predictors of polypharmacy in patients with epilepsy and Intellectual disabilities (IDs) residing in group homes versus family homes. METHODS This nine-year retrospective study analyzed patients with epilepsy and IDs who were admitted to the EMU, epilepsy clinics at LHSC and rehabilitation clinics for patients with IDs at Parkwood Institution. The study included individuals aged 16 years and older residing in either group homes or family homes. Data on demographics, epilepsy characteristics, and ASMs use were collected and analyzed using the Statistical Package for Social Sciences. The study utilized binary logistic regression to identify predictors of polypharmacy in patients with epilepsy and IDs. RESULTS The study enrolled a total of 81 patients, of which 59.3 % resided in family homes. Group home residents were significantly older (41 vs. 24.5 years; p = 0.0001) and were prescribed more ASMs (3 vs. 2; p = 0.002). Specific ASMs were more common in group homes, including valproic acid (54.5 % vs. 25.0 %), lacosamide (54.5 % vs. 22.9 %), topiramate (33.3 % vs. 14.6 %), and phenytoin (30.3 % vs. 6.2 %). Admission to the EMU was more prevalent in group homes (93.9 % vs. 52.1 %; p = 0.0001). Living in a group home increased the risk of polypharmacy (OR = 10.293, p = 0.005), as did older epilepsy onset age (OR = 1.135, p = 0.031) and generalized or focal & generalized epilepsy (OR = 7.153, p = 0.032 and OR = 10.442, p = 0.025, respectively). SIGNIFICANCE Our study identified notable differences in the demographic and clinical characteristics of patients with epilepsy and IDs living in group homes versus family homes. Age of epilepsy onset, EMU admissions, epilepsy types, and residency setting were significant predictors of polypharmacy. These findings highlight the need for personalized care strategies and increased awareness of the potential risks associated with polypharmacy.
